Quick Assessment
This comprehensive learning kit is designed for children ages 9-12 to reinforce number recognition, counting, basic addition and subtraction, as well as concepts of time and money. Developed by educators, it includes workbooks, flash cards, and engaging songs to support classroom learning through repetition and varied activities. The materials are suitable for middle-grade learners and provide a solid foundation in early math skills without any concerning content.
